## Runbook: Incremental Rebuilds — Stonepress

Stonepress rebuilds only pages whose source changed since the last publish. If output looks stale, clear `.stonepress/cache` and rerun `stonepress build --incremental`. Full rebuilds take about twenty minutes; incremental ones under two. Publishing pushes artifacts to the Ledgewick CDN, which requires a deploy token set on the line below.

vault entry, yahaf-tagug: LEDGER_TOKEN20=884d77d1a8b98aa4edfb

TURN-208: Gatevale turnstile counters at the Merrow Field pilot double-count when a rotation reverses mid-cycle. Attendance totals drift roughly 2% high per event. The debounce window fix is implemented, reviewed by Ilsa, and soak-tested across two simulated match days without drift. Ready for your cut; the candidate build is identified below.

trace token, tagag-tafog: htk6_5ed18c

**Changelog — PortionWise Key Rotation**

On schedule, we rotated the release signing key for PortionWise, the recipe-scaling calculator. Builds 3.8.0 and later are signed with the new key; older builds remain valid under the retired key until end of quarter. Support should direct users who see verification warnings to update the app rather than reinstall. No recipes, saved scaling presets, or unit preferences are affected. For verification requests, the current signing key is as follows.

deploy key for kajof-fajop: bky6_gDHw9Q

## Account Recovery — Trailnote Offline Mode

When a surveyor's Trailnote app has been offline for 30+ days, their local credentials expire and sync refuses to resume. Don't make them wipe the device — all their unsynced field data lives there! Instead, open the support console, pick "Offline Reinstate," and enter their handle. The console will ask for the support team's shared recovery passphrase before issuing a reinstatement token. Use the one below.

unlock words, bagaf-fajeg: zorael-kelax-fraath-quenix-eliok-sileth-aldmir-wenir-druiel

Ticket: Staging env misconfigured for Siftgate bloom filter

The bloom layer in front of the Pellet KV store is rejecting all lookups in staging because the env file was copied from the dev template without credentials. False-positive tuning values are fine; only the auth line is missing. To unblock the weekly demo, the Pellet admission secret must be set on the following line.

env line for yaguf-fajop: LEDGER_TOKEN13=fb08984397349